Detecting Imperfections – creating perfection
Painting a new-build yacht is a complex process involving several layers. After applying a corrosion protection primer, the uneven hull and superstructure are transformed into a smooth surface using fairing compounds and high-build surfacers. In conventional yacht new-building, this is usually followed by an epoxy-based finish primer, and the topcoat is applied afterwards. The high-gloss topcoat shall reveal unevenness that was not visible on the more matt finish primer. Until now, this meant that the first layer of topcoat had to be sacrificed to detect and rework the imperfections.
Saving a layer – boosting the paint job
With this high solids HS Prime Coat 435, this sacrificial layer of topcoat is no longer necessary, as even the smallest imperfections are visible in the glossy finish of the prime coat and can be reworked. The prime coat, with its polyurethane-based formulation, not only offers detective functionality—other parameters also ensure that the painting process is optimized, and the painters’ work becomes faster and easier.
- Prime Coat comes along with a good hiding power at a dry film thickness of approximately 50 µm.
- The lower layer thickness leads to faster drying and higher stability in comparison to standard epoxy primers.
- Formulated with an impressive proportion of high-solid components, it leads to less VOC emission and less shrinkage while drying and is easy to sand.
- Available in White and Gray to be a perfect base for all color shades of topcoat.
HS Prime Coat 435 can be used as an undercoat before topcoating, either on top of Super Build 302 or Finish Primer 442. It is the ideal choice when applicators want to use the primer as an optical control layer at the same time.
